AGARTALA, April 10 (TIWN): The Essential Services Maintenance Act (ESMA) imposition in Tripura amid COVID19 pandemic has erupted political tension in state.
The opposition CPI-M Party has triggered massive criticism about the Govt’s decision.
The controversy erupted as soon as Chief Minister Biplab Deb tweeted, “In order to better manage #COVID-19 outbreak in the interest of citizens, from today the Government has implemented the Essential Services Management Act (ESMA) with immediate effect in Tripura”.
CPI-M has thrown a question to the Govt, although ESMA will collect works from health staffs but whether ESMA can collect ‘service’ from those health staffs for patients ?
On yesterday two top CPI-M leaders gave separate statements condemning the ESMA implementation in state.
MP Govt has also invoked the same law in state.
